Vacancy Details: Health Department Sindh Recruitment 2026
The Government of Sindh is filling several technical and administrative positions. Below is the official distribution of seats:
| Job Title | BPS | Total Posts | Qualification Required |
| Computer Operator | 12 | 110 | Graduate + 1-Year Diploma in Computer Science |
Job Description
- System Operations: Starting/stopping programs and managing daily computer console operations.
- Data Management: Executing high-accuracy data entry and maintaining departmental databases.
- Backups & Security: Performing regular data backups and adhering to strict government confidentiality protocols.
- Technical Support: Troubleshooting basic hardware/software issues and providing IT support to staff.
- Reporting: Generating operational reports and maintaining detailed system logs.
- Maintenance: Ensuring equipment upkeep and coordinating repairs for computer peripherals.
- Administration: Performing clerical tasks and managing digital filing systems to ensure smooth workflow.

The Role of STS and SIBA Testing Service
A mandatory requirement for these posts is that candidates must have passed the STS Graduation Category or Matric Category screening test (as applicable) with a minimum of 40 marks.

Documents Checklist for Application
Before sitting down to apply on the SJP portal, ensure you have scanned copies of the following:
- CNIC (Front and Back).
- Recent Passport-sized Photograph.
- Domicile and PRC (Form D) of Sindh Province.
- Degree/Matric Certificate and Marksheets.
- One-year Computer Diploma (for BPS-12 posts).
- STS Passing Certificate/Result Card.

Essential Terms and Conditions
- Quota Reservations: The Government of Sindh’s policy regarding women, disabled persons, and minority quotas will be strictly followed.
- Urban vs. Rural: Positions are distributed according to urban and rural quotas as per Sindh government rules.
- Existing Employees: Those already serving in government departments must apply through the proper channel (NOC).
- Shortlisting: Only candidates meeting the STS 40% threshold will be shortlisted for interviews.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Can I apply for more than one post?
Yes, if you meet the eligibility criteria for multiple posts (e.g., both Computer Operator and Data Entry Operator), you can apply for both through the portal.
What is the passing mark for the STS test for these jobs?
According to the advertisement, you must have scored at least 40 marks in the STS screening test to be eligible for consideration.
Is there any age relaxation?
The advertised age limit is 21-28 years; however, general age relaxation may be applicable as per the Government of Sindh’s current policy at the time of recruitment.
Do I need to send hard copies of my documents?
No, the initial application is entirely online. Hard copies/original documents are only required at the time of the interview for verification.
I have a degree but no computer diploma. Can I apply for Computer Operator?
No. The advertisement specifically requires a one-year diploma in Computer Science from a recognized technical board in addition to your degree.
